What is Trina Solar?
Trina solar produces a large range of solar panels for residential, commercial and utility-scale installations, incorporating many of the latest cell technologies including bifacial, half-cell, dual glass, PERC, and more recently the advanced N-type TOPCon monocrystalline cells.
Is Trina Solar a good brand?
Trina Solar competes with some of the top brands on the market, but they’re not number one in any category. Trina Solar does everything pretty well (efficiency, temperature coefficient, warranties, price, etc.), but there’s usually a premium solar panel brand that does it better.
What bifacial panels does Trina Solar offer?
For larger commercial and utility-scale installations, Trina Solar offers high voltage (1500V) larger format 72 or 144 half-cut cell panels in the TallMax and DuoMax bifacial range, with sizes now exceeding 600W. Trina also produces specialised dual glass and advanced bifacial options with 30-year performance warranties.

How much do solar panels cost?
The biggest factor for solar panel costs will be the size of the PV system you specify. The MCS collates data for certified installs across England, Scotland, Wales and Northern Ireland. This shows that, so far in 2023 (up to the end of September), the typical price per kW of installed solar PV in domestic properties was £2,193.
How much does a solar PV system cost?
The Energy Saving Trust (EST) suggests a typical domestic solar PV system is somewhat smaller, at 3.5kW and around £7,000; although that does put prices in a similar ballpark of approximately £2,000 per kW.
Can a solar PV system save you money?
The most robust information available on potential solar PV savings comes from the Energy Saving Trust. Based on a 3.5kW solar panel system costing £7,000 to install, and current energy prices (Oct 2023), its research suggests households who are at home all day can save up to £525 per year with the SEG, versus £400 without.

How much do solar panels cost in 2023?
This shows that, so far in 2023 (up to the end of September), the typical price per kW of installed solar PV in domestic properties was £2,193. Back in 2021, the average cost was just £1,661 per kW. So, solar panel costs have risen significantly, reflecting general construction sector inflation.

How much power does Trina Solar have?
In 2020, Trina Solar launched high power series – Vertex series modules. The module power ranges from 500W to 670W, and the highest module e ciency can reach 21.6%. The Vertex series modules come in two versions – the bifacial dual-glass modules and back sheet modules.
Does Trina Solar have a p-type PV module?
Trina's Vertex PV module. Chinese module maker Trina Solar has announced to have achieved a power conversion efficiency of 23.03% for a monocrystalline p-type module based on 66 PERC cells with a size of 210×210 mm. The result was confirmed by Germany's standards bodies TÜV Rheinland and TÜV Nord.
Does Trina Solar have a good efficiency rating?
Trina Solar said TÜV Nord in Germany has confirmed the efficiency rating of its latest solar cell. China's Trina Solar has revealed that it has achieved a power conversion efficiency of 24.24% for an n-type TOPCon solar cell based on 210 mm wafers. The results have been confirmed by TÜV Nord in Germany.
Is Trina A P-type PERC solar cell?
In mid-July, Trina achieved a power conversion efficiency of 24.5% for a p-type PERC solar cell based on 210 mm wafers. These results, confirmed by the State Key Laboratory of PV Science and Technology in China, represented a world record for this cell type, it claimed.
How efficient is Trina Solar I-Topcon?
The results have been confirmed by TÜV Nord in Germany. “In March, Trina Solar brought the maximum efficiency of 25.5% for large-area 210 × 210mm i-TOPCon cells, setting a new world record for industrial large-area n-type i-TOPCon cell, the company said in a statement.
